Solomon Farrington was born in 1808 in Rowan County, North Carolina, USA, the child of Solomon Farrington And Unknown Farrington. Solomon Farrington married Unknown Farrington, and had children including Carolina Farrington, Don Fernando Farrington, Josie Farrington, Sarah Farrington, Unknown Holderman, William Harman Farrington. Solomon Farrington passed away in 1854 in Scott County, Illinois, USA.
